The Los Angeles Chargers gameday experience at SoFi Stadium is modern, stylish, and high-energy—yet still evolving. Since moving to L.A., the Chargers have worked to build a stronger local fan base, and while the crowd can be mixed, the overall experience is exciting thanks to the state-of-the-art venue, elite-level talent on the field, and vibrant Southern California atmosphere.


1) The Venue: SoFi Stadium

  • SoFi is one of the most advanced and visually stunning stadiums in the world.

  • Features:

    • A massive dual-sided 4K Oculus video board that circles the field

    • Climate-controlled open-air design (you feel the breeze, not the heat)

    • Clean, modern architecture with sleek LED lighting and massive digital displays

  • Every seat has a great view; it feels more like an NFL theater experience than a traditional football stadium.

The Los Angeles Chargers tailgating experience at SoFi Stadium is a more laid-back, urban version of traditional NFL tailgating—with a SoCal twist. While it may not rival the epic tailgates of places like Kansas City or Buffalo in size or intensity, Chargers fans bring energy, loyalty, and creativity to the lots. It’s a scene that’s growing and uniquely L.A.


1) Where It Happens

Tailgating is allowed in select parking lots at SoFi Stadium in Inglewood, including:

  • Lots P and Q (most active)

  • Lots N, E, and D (for smaller tailgate setups)

  • RV Tailgating is allowed with specific passes

Lots open 4 hours before kickoff, and fans usually arrive early to secure good spots—especially for division games or primetime matchups.

5) Pro Tips

  • Tailgate passes are required and can sell out for big games—buy early.

  • There are no open flames or charcoal grills allowed; propane only.

  • Bring sun protection—there’s little natural shade in the lots.

  • Tailgating ends at kickoff, and alcohol must be put away before entering the stadium.
